There’s finally been a breakthrough in Kyiv’s request for Leopard 2 tanks

Germany’s foreign minister Annalena Baerbock said she “would not stand in the way” of Poland if they were to send Leopard 2 tanks to Ukraine — but they had yet to formally ask.

Poland is one of several nations – including Finland, Slovakia, Sweden and the Netherlands – that ave expressed interest in sending these tanks, which are considered ‘heavy’ artillery.

They’re high on Ukraine’s wishlist because they were specifically designed to compete with the Russian T90 tanks, which are being used in the invasion.

Poland confirmed it would formally send a request to export some of these tanks.

Moscow is not happy with the news.

They’ve warned for weeks that it could be seen as an escalation from the west – and could provoke a more direct response.
